Welcome

Since 1995, Monica’s Organic Products has been creating Florida-made soaps and personal care products inspired by nature and crafted with purpose.

What began as a mother’s commitment to healthier living has grown into a family business serving customers for more than three decades.

We believe everyone deserves access to quality personal care products made with integrity, kindness, and respect.

From our signature CocoCastile soaps to shampoos, creams, body washes, and deodorants, every product is created with the same goal:

To build a bridge between nature and the people seeking healing, comfort, and care.

  4. Hello Monica.

    What’s in your body wash?

    Thanks!

      1. Hello Nicole our premium body wash is made from our organic CocoCastile formula that we use for the base and we enhance the skin moisturizer benefits with colloidal oatmeal, Aloe Vera for ph and horsetail for a super gentle deep cleaning that leaves your whole body feeling great all day long.   11. We were staying at Kate’s Fish Camp after I had fallen on my bike and had some pretty deep scrapes. Kate offered me a white bar of soap with ridges that she broke in half for me, is that the same as what was in the sample gift pack? It is working great on eczema.

    1. Hello Peggy, I am so happy to hear that the soap is helping your skin.
      All of our soaps are made with the same ingredients, only difference is the essential oils used to scent the different types.
      Our liquid is also made with our Coco Castle formula. Monica created for her children back in the 1990’s to help with skin and scalp irritation. Soaps made with standard soap oils and processing are harsh and made with unclean ingredients that people can find very irritating. And in my family’s experience the dermatologist recommended basically the same products just more expensive and more pain relievers and anti-itch agents. When it has been common knowledge that soap made with first-pressed extra virgin olive oil at 60 to 80% actually heals skin cells as well as cleansing. To that we add virgin coconut oil to enhance the lather, creating a super bubbly, clean rinsing, moisturizing soap that you can use on your hair, face, body, teeth and shave with better than the top commercial brands in each of the categories. So in closing to answer your question, Yes, the samples that Monica gave you in the welcome gift and the piece that Monica cut off for your skin to heal are all made with extra virgin olive oil and virgin coconut oil. I recommend the UNSCENTED or Oatmeal for eczema. Also Eucalyptus lavender tea tree and Lavender by itself are relaxing and medicinal.
